The key factors driving the real estate market in India include infrastructure development, government initiatives, increasing demand for affordable housing, and the growth of industries like IT and healthcare.
Cities like Pune, Ahmedabad, and Kochi are emerging as top real estate hotspots due to their strategic locations, robust infrastructure, and growing economic activities.
The government is supporting the real estate sector through initiatives like the 'Housing for All' and 'Smart Cities Mission,' which aim to address the housing shortage and improve urban infrastructure.
Sustainable development plays a crucial role in the real estate sector by promoting eco-friendly practices and smart technologies, which enhance the value and appeal of properties and address environmental concerns.
